“Easy there,” Nico says, grabbing the glass from me. “You’ve had enough.”
I want to snap at him but a sudden feeling of happiness overwhelms me. It’s pure bliss. Pure pleasure.
“You didn’t answer Jonathan’s question,” Antonio says.
Nico snaps his eyes at him. “You want to know if my wife was a virgin or not. Well, she claims she’s not. But I think otherwise.”
“You haven’t claimed her yet?” Adrien asks, a glint in his eyes I don’t like.
“When the time is right, I will make Sasha fully mine. But I’m not an animal. I’m not going to rape my wife. I kill men who try to rape my wife.” The threat is clear: don’t come near me or Nico will hurt you.
The warmth of the alcohol spreads through my body. I never knew that one glass of wine could do this to a person. I start to giggle to myself as my hands skim along the table. The wood feels so powerful and strong and hard and warm. That thought makes me laugh harder.
Nico frowns. “Sasha?”
“Touch this,” I whisper, grabbing his hand and slamming it onto the table. “Feel how soft it is. How warm.”
“Is she all right?” Adrien’s date asks.
“A real sacrificial lamb,” Antonio comments, eyeing me over. I stare at him for a moment before I burst out laughing even harder. He flinches, then frowns. “You can tell us, girl, if you’re a virgin or not.”
“Don’t ask my wife that,” Nico growls. “Only I get to talk to her like that. I’m your boss, Antonio. Show some fucking respect.”
He averts his eyes from me. “Of course.” But then I feel his hand on my thigh and it makes me startle. I have to admit… it feels good. Even softer than the table. Warmer too.
I sigh as I lean back in my seat. Why do I feel sogoodall of a sudden? Everything looks brighter. Everything feels softer. Everything makes me feel alive.
I’ve never felt this way before. If I had known wine would make me feel this way, I would have started drinking the moment I showed up here.
“You have your hand on my thigh,” I giggle.
Nico shoots to his feet and grabs my chair, scooting it back with me in it. I almost fall right out of it but I grip the sides, steadying myself. Antonio removes his hand but not fast enough.
Nico sees it happen.
“Why the fuck are you trying to touch my wife?” he demands.
“You’re my boss. I respect you.”
“Oh, you do, do you?”
“You haven’t claimed her yet,” he objects. “It’s not my fault I wanted a little slice of innocence.”
“I’m not innocent,” I giggle. “Or maybe I am.” Why is everything so funny to me right now? Does wine really do this to a person? I don’t remember my mom ever acting this way.
Nico stares down at me for a long moment before he picks up my wine glass and sniffs it. “Is there something in her drink?” He sticks his finger to the bottom and when he pulls it back out, there’s a tiny bit of something powdery on his skin. “Did youdrugmy wife?”
Antonio raises his hands in surrender while everyone at the table looks at him in shock. Well everyone except Adrien. He’s smirking at me like he has a secret.
“No, I swear,” Antonio says.
Nico slams the glass down onto the table. “Did you drug my wife, Antonio? You touched her thigh. Why the fuck do you think you could do that at my own party?”
“Because you fucked me over!” he shouts, jumping to his feet. “You were supposed to pay me for the job I did for you in Sicily and never paid me. You fucked me over, Nico. So fine. I wanted to have a little fun with your wife. Everyone has been talking about her. About how innocent she is. I wanted a little taste. See if it was real. I also heard she was high strung so I might have given her something to loosen her up.”
“You drugged her,” he says flatly.
“It’s for your own benefit. You were telling Adrien that you haven’t fucked her yet. I thought I was doing you a favor by speeding it along.”
